Welcome to Patterns

A React Native and TypeScript mobile app. A journal to record thoughts and feelings, either by typing, or with voice transcripts using text-to-speech native iOS and Android functionalities.

Auth and storage handled by Supabase (free-tier).

Test suite built using Jest and React Testing Library. Use npx jest to run the tests.

Use npx expo start to run the local server. Outdated: this was good until we had the voice native module, which does not work on Expo Go. Now if you wanna run the app in the simulator, you need to run the developer build:

cd ios
pod install
cd ..
npx expo run:ios

It will take a minute. The pod install is necessary only the first time. npx expo run:ios will suffice unless you make changes that require it to make the build

At the moment I am developing for iOS and not android, because the text-to-speech is fully on-device in iOS, while in android, Google needs to connect to the internet to query the speech recognition service. I wanted to try to develop this in the lightest possible way at first.

Use an iOS simulator (I'm using iPhone 17 set up via XCode) or an Android emulator (Pixel 10 via Android studio)
